Crime Beat Season 5 Episode 13 Homicide 42
- TV14
- February 23, 2024
It was 1am on a cold, wet November night in 2011 when police found Leanne Freeman lying unconscious in a pool of blood; she later died in a downtown hospital, becoming Toronto's 42nd homicide of the year.